In this episode of Inside the Polygraph, David Goldberg answers some of the most common questions he's been receiving from listeners, clients, and viewers across all of his social media platforms.

From pre-employment polygraph examinations to the dangers of online referral services, David shares practical advice based on decades of investigative experience and more than 25 years as a board-certified polygraph examiner.

David also revisits a heartbreaking domestic homicide that mirrors the warning signs discussed in the previous episode, emphasizing the importance of recognizing dangerous relationship behaviors before tragedy strikes.

The episode concludes with David discussing his experience conducting a polygraph examination for an individual connected to the Jeffrey Epstein investigation, offering his perspective on victim credibility, manipulation, coercion, and why truth, verification, and due process matter in high-profile cases.

In This Episode:

  • A follow-up to the previous episode on infidelity and domestic homicide
  • Recognizing dangerous warning signs before violence escalates
  • Why first responders deserve greater recognition for the work they do
  • What happens if you fail or receive an inconclusive result on a pre-employment polygraph
  • When and how a polygraph appeal may be possible
  • Why one failed polygraph should not end your law enforcement career
  • The risks of using online polygraph referral services
  • Why researching your examiner is one of the most important decisions you'll make
  • David's perspective after conducting a polygraph examination involving an individual connected to the Jeffrey Epstein investigation
  • Understanding manipulation, coercion, victimization, and why victims deserve to be heard
  • The importance of truth, credibility, and professional investigations over rumors and speculation

Throughout the episode, David reminds listeners that the goal of a polygraph examination is not simply to answer questions, but to help truthful people obtain clarity, protect their integrity, and move forward with confidence.
